How do you clear time on a Volvo S60 regular service?

Volvo reset Time for Regular Service procedure

  1. Put key into ignition.
  2. Press and hold trip reset or T1/T2 button on the instrument cluster.
  3. Turn key into II position while still holding the trip reset button.
  4. Wait until yellow indicator starts to blink.
  5. While the yellow indicator is blinking, release the button.

How do you clear regular service time on a Volvo?

Step 1: Reset Maintenance Message

  1. Press and hold trip reset button,
  2. turn on the ignition,
  3. wait for the yellow warning light to start blinking,
  4. release the button and wait for confirmations sound,
  5. turn off the ignition,
  6. turn the ignition back on to check if the service message is gone.

How do I reset my Volvo on Call service required?

For Volvos with the SPA Sensus Connect System:

  1. Tap the tab on the upper edge of the display (you will see Settings or Owner’s Manual)
  2. Select Settings.
  3. Select System.
  4. Select Global Reset.
  5. Select Factory Reset.
  6. Select OK.
